Pioneering 3D scanning technology
The Revopoint Metrox, with a combination of hybrid multi -band laser and total blue structured light, allows for a professional 3D modeling of small and medium -sized objects. The device can capture the most complicated details and invisible surface features with up to fourteen crossing laser lines and seven parallel lines and the stunning light structure of 62, reaching up to 0.01 mm single-cubic accuracy and 0.03 mm full accuracy. Such a detailed work makes the scanner an excellent choice for all demanding users.
Versatility in a device
The Metrox model does not require a matte spray to scan the bright or black surfaces. The device quickly records the data in multi -lane laser mode at up to 800 000 points per second and in full field light mode at up to 7,000,000 points per second. The flexible mounting area (160 × 70 mm from 200 mm to 320 × 215 mm from 400 mm) is ideal for both engineering studios and design offices. This tool revolutionizes the way of scanning objects.

Revo Scan software
Revo Scan is an extremely intuitive device that helps you throughout the scan process - from the adjustment of the scan parameters to the automatic or manual processing of the point cloud to the editing, the merger of the model segments, and to export to PLY, OBJ, STL, ASC, 3MF, GLTF or FBX. You can easily remove unwanted data, smooth out surfaces, fill the cavities and combine partial scans to create a consistent model that is ready for further processing in software such as Quicksurface, Geomagic Wrap, or Geomagic Control. The built -in calibration wizard provides accurate and reliable measurement results.
